Transaction 138af6683b7c48dcda69d0ee48231676f2caa9580a0622894398509ffe66cffa
1 Input
1 Output
-
138af6683b7c48dcda69d0ee48231676f2caa9580a0622894398509ffe66cffa:0
- value
- 567602
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ec914ab018e6531e821891057930716e42ca0076 OP_EQUAL
- address
- 3PFsSs2xh2vSTFuPVv1JYvVQUP1UdDeodw